About Integrated Self-Defense
Integrated Self-Defense in Colorado Springs is a family-owned Jujutsu-based self-defense academy run by Samantha Sargent, who came to Jujutsu in 2020 from a Taekwondo background, with instructor and coach Mateo C, a Colorado Springs native who added Jujutsu in 2021 and works in the youth programme. The academy is explicit that it does not teach traditional Taekwondo or Karate — it draws strikes, kicks, blocks and punches from a range of disciplines but keeps the focus on applying Jujutsu principles for self-defense. Training is priced per class at $25, or $99 a month for one or two classes a week, with 30-minute private lessons at $30 and a buy-one-get-one-half-price family offer.
